As a Speech Language Pathologist, you will take initiative, responsibility, and action every day; you understand physical, mental, psychological and social needs of your patients. You have an understanding of communication skills, evaluation, and treatment and a desire to work in collaboration with associates to provide quality interdisciplinary patient programming. You will provide a comprehensive evaluation of communication skills and/or swallowing function and provide goal-oriented treatment to facilitate maximum communication and/or swallowing potential.

Qualifications

How you will be successful in this environment:

You will demonstrate an understanding of patient needs, ensuring that each patient feels informed and understood, as well as heard. You are passionate about providing superior quality care and you are an inventive problem solver who thrives in a dynamic environment.

  • Graduation from a program satisfying the American Speech/Language/Hearing Association's academic and practicum requirements for the Certificate of Clinical Competence (CCC).
  • You hold a valid license issued by the State in which you are practicing.
  • You have at least two (2) years of related experience.
  • Possessing a Basic Life Support (BLS) certification.
  • Critical care experience in a hospital setting is a plus.
